All aboard the North Pole Express! This magical experience is hosted by the Florida Railroad Museum and begins at the Parrish railroad station. The train departs on select evenings throughout the month of December.

Although these tickets usually sell out months before the event, you can still wait at the station and hope for a cancellation. There are no guarantees, obviously, but if any tickets are still unclaimed 20 minutes before the ride, they are sold to standby guests (seating and prices vary).

Tickets range from $24.50 to $59.50, depending on dates and which car you choose. The caboose can be rented for up to 16 people with one flat charge. During the 30-minute ride to the North Pole, carolers walk the aisles, singing your favorite Christmas songs.

Once you arrive at the North Pole, your family can enjoy the lights and decorations, unlimted hot chocolate and cookies, a model train display, and arts and crafts.

Families can even purchase s’mores kits to cook together over the campfires. Dinner options are also available for hungry guests.

Don’t forget the most magical part! The train will not depart until every child gets to meet Santa and tell him what they want for Christmas this year.
